Emirates Aluminum to build USD3b alumina refinery


(MENAFN) Emirates Global Aluminum announced it is planning to invest USD3 billion in building an alumina refinery in Abu Dhabi, Gulf Business reported.

The new alumina refinery is expected to be operational by the end of 2017, and the alumina, extracted from bauxite in the refining process, will be used to produce primary aluminum.

"We are building the refinery to secure our own important materials, the refinery would ultimately produce 4 million tons annually," Emirates Global Aluminum Chief Executive said.

Emirates Global Aluminum is currently the world's fifth-largest aluminum company and is valued at about USD15 billion.
